## Local Setup

Hey plugin folks! Ledgerbee's billing worker ships blue-green, so your plugin needs to survive both colors running at once. Run `bee up` to spin the green stack locally, then `bee flip` to simulate cutover. Idempotency is on you — the worker may replay your hooks during the flip window. Plugins read invoice state from the sandbox database; point your local config at it using the connection string below.

primary connection of yagep-kahip = redis://giliel_svc:zYiKsLL2PLpfPL@db-348f.xolmarsys.corp:5432/fenwyn

- [ ] **Step 7: Breaker override escrow.** After sealing the signing keys for the Tallgrove upstream API circuit breaker, confirm the support team can force the breaker open during a full outage. The override bundle lives in the sealed escrow drawer and is useless without its unlock phrase. Two ceremony witnesses must initial this step before proceeding. The escrow bundle is decrypted with the recovery passphrase that follows.

vault phrase of kahip-kahop = holath-quenmir

Runbook: account recovery for StockCart, the vending-machine restock planner used by Harrowfield Refreshments. If a route planner account is locked after failed logins, verify the requester against the roster in the Opsbook wiki, then reset via the StockCart admin console. If the admin console itself is inaccessible, use the break-glass account. New team members: the break-glass passphrase is recorded directly below.

unlock words, kajef-kadug: sorys-pelax-lamael-tamvan-briiel-novdor-fenwyn-tamdor-oliion-keleth-julok-belion-ralok